Product Description:
The Bosch Rexroth Indramat MDD065A-N-060-N2M-095GA0 is a compact AC synchronous motor in the MDD Synchronous Motors series. It is intended for use with digital drive controllers, where commanded current is converted into precise rotary motion for high-speed axes in packaging machines, pick-and-place units, and light conveyor sections. The compact housing helps the motor fit machines that need fast response without taking excessive installation space. Its mechanical package follows the 065 size envelope and A-length code, so it can be matched to the proper frame without additional adapter parts.
The service interface uses a connector arrangement, and all power and feedback conductors exit on side A, which helps keep cable routing parallel to the machine frame. This cable exit direction can reduce sharp bends near the housing when the motor is mounted close to guides or guarding. Mounting accuracy is supported by a centering pilot of 95 mm, which helps seat the motor concentrically in the mating flange. Under continuous current, the motor provides 0.8 Nm of standstill torque, which is suitable for holding light loads or maintaining position between short moves. It reaches a rated speed of 6000 rpm, allowing quick cycle times when the paired drive supplies the required electrical frequency.
The output uses a plain shaft with a shaft seal, which supports friction-fit couplings while helping keep dust and lubricant away from the front bearing area. Position information comes from an integrated multi-turn absolute encoder, so the drive can read rotor position immediately after power-up without a reference run. The feedback signal is transmitted through digital servo feedback (DSF), providing high-resolution position data for closed-loop control. Absolute position retention also supports restart behavior when an axis cannot perform a full homing move at startup. The motor also uses standard dynamic balancing and a housing intended for natural convection, which supports smooth running in compact automated equipment.
